Mastering High-Performance Cooling: The Aspera J7238GE Professional Overview

In the world of commercial refrigeration and industrial climate control, the Aspera J7238GE stands as a testament to Slovakian engineering precision. This 1.5 HP powerhouse is specifically designed for High Back Pressure (HBP) applications, making it a “go-to” choice for engineers managing large-scale walk-in coolers, industrial water chillers, and specialized air conditioning units.

Operating on R407C, an environmentally conscious HFC blend, the J7238GE provides a robust cooling capacity exceeding 13,000 BTU/h. Unlike standard household compressors, this unit utilizes a CSR (Capacitor Start – Run) motor configuration. This ensures high starting torque, allowing the compressor to kick in even under heavy thermal loads without tripping the thermal protection.

For the field worker, the reliability of the Slovakia-made Embraco/Aspera line is legendary. It handles the stresses of fluctuating ambient temperatures with grace, provided the maintenance of the forced-air cooling system is kept in check.

Engineering Insight: R407C vs. R22 and R404A

When comparing the J7238GE to older R22 models or newer R404A units, several factors emerge:

  • Glide: R407C has a significant temperature glide. As an engineer, you must ensure the system is charged in the liquid phase to maintain the correct blend ratio.
  • Heat Transfer: R407C offers excellent heat transfer coefficients in HBP ranges, often outperforming R134a in similar physical footprints.
  • Displacement: With a 32.7 cc displacement, the J7238GE moves a significant volume of gas, making it far more efficient for medium-to-large commercial cabinets than the standard NJ series used in smaller retail fridges.

Maintenance and Field Advice

  1. Oil Management: This compressor uses POE oil. It is extremely hygroscopic (absorbs moisture quickly). Never leave the system open to the atmosphere for more than 15 minutes.
  2. Start Components: Always check the potential relay and capacitors if the compressor hums but fails to start. A weakened 20µF run capacitor is often the silent killer of these motors.
  3. Vibration: Ensure the mounting grommets are secure. The J7238GE is a heavy-duty reciprocating model; excessive vibration can lead to copper fatigue and subsequent leaks.

High-Performance Cooling: The ZMC GL90TB Deep Dive

The HVAC and commercial refrigeration industry relies heavily on components that can withstand constant cycling while maintaining thermal stability. The ZMC GL90TB stands as a workhorse in this category. Specifically engineered for High Back Pressure (HBP) applications, this 1/4 HP unit is the “go-to” for technicians servicing commercial bottle coolers and large-scale water dispensers.

Unlike standard household compressors designed for Low Back Pressure (LBP), the GL90TB is optimized for higher evaporation temperatures. This makes it significantly more efficient at removing heat quickly from a warm environment, such as a beverage fridge in a high-traffic retail store.

Comparative Analysis: GL90TB vs. GL90AA

A common mistake in the field is confusing the GL90TB with its cousin, the GL90AA. While they share similar displacement, the “TB” is rated for HBP/CBP, whereas the “AA” is strictly LBP.

  • Startup Torque: The GL90TB utilizes a CSIR motor, providing the high starting torque necessary to overcome high pressures in commercial settings.
  • Thermal Load: The GL90TB manages a thermal load nearly 40% higher than LBP units of the same size.

Engineering Insights & Maintenance

As a field expert, I recommend always ensuring that the condenser fan is functioning at peak RPM. Since this compressor is built for high-demand cooling, it generates significant heat. Lack of airflow is the number one cause of premature winding failure in the Egyptian-made ZMC units.

Expert Tip: When replacing a GL90TB, always replace the start capacitor and the filter drier. A 1/4 HP HBP system is sensitive to moisture; even a trace amount can lead to wax buildup in the capillary tube.

The AE16LMY compressor is a versatile hermetic compressor designed for both R134a (medium/high temperature) and R404a (low temperature) applications. Below is a detailed breakdown of its specifications, cooling capacities, applications, and key features when operating in High Back Pressure (HBP) mode with R134a and Low Back Pressure (LBP) mode with R404a .


AE16LMY Compressor Overview

General Specifications

  • Nominal Horsepower (HP):
    • R134a Mode (HBP): 3/8 HP
    • R404a Mode (LBP): 5/8 HP
  • Displacement:
    • R134a Mode (HBP): 17.4 cc
    • R404a Mode (LBP): 14.5 cc
  • Motor Type: CSIR (Capacitor Start Induction Run) / CSR (Capacitor Start Run) with FC C/V control
  • Weight: 13.7 kg
  • Lubricant: Emkarate RL22HB POE (Polyolester lubricant)
  • Connections: Rotolock suction and discharge connections

The SECOP FR7GH (103G6683) is a hermetic reciprocating compressor designed for refrigeration applications, particularly those utilizing the refrigerant R134a. Here are the detailed specifications and features:

Specifications

  • Model: FR7GH
  • Part Number: 103G6683
  • Refrigerant: R134a
  • Power Rating: Approximately 1/5 HP
  • Voltage:

    • 220-240V at 50/60Hz
    • 208-230V at 60Hz

  • Displacement: 6.88 cm³ (0.42 in³)
  • Cooling Capacity:

    • Approximately 1320 BTU/h at +20°F
    • Approximately 2537 BTU/h at +45°F

  • Operating Temperature Range: Suitable for medium to high back pressure (M/HBP) applications cooling.
  • Oil Type: Polyolester oil (POE)
